The average salary for a Languages and Literature Instructor in the United States is approximately $63,651 annually or about $31 per hour. This figure can vary based on multiple factors, including geographic location, years of experience, and the type of educational institution. In general, instructors in urban areas or prestigious universities tend to earn higher salaries compared to those in rural or less recognized institutions.

A languages and literature instructor's salary ranges from $43,000 a year at the 10th percentile to $94,000 at the 90th percentile.

| Percentile | Annual salary | Monthly salary | Hourly r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| 90th Percentile | $94,000 | $7,833 | $45 |
| 75th Percentile | $78,000 | $6,500 | $38 |
| Average | $63,651 | $5,304 | $31 |
| 25th Percentile | $51,000 | $4,250 | $25 |
| 10th Percentile | $43,000 | $3,583 | $21 |

The average languages and literature instructor salary has risen by $9,367 over the last ten years. In 2014, the average languages and literature instructor earned $54,284 annually, but today, they earn $63,651 a year. That works out to a 10% change in pay for languages and literature instructors over the last decade.
